Staggered Stud Wall

After carefully inspecting 8 random Tstuds from the shipment of 2200 lineal feet we received, I have decided to return it all. Because it is a lumber-based product, a 10-15% cull rate would not be unusual. For whatever reason, however, the quality control on the product we received was not to an acceptable standard for use on our project. Instead, I have decided to use LVL 2×4’s to build a staggered stud wall (wood is a poor insulator and the goal is to avoid creating a bridge from the inside wall to the outside wall). Laminated veneer lumber (LVL) is an engineered wood product that uses multiple layers of thin wood assembled with adhesives. Made in a factory under controlled specifications, it is stronger, straighter, and more uniform than conventional lumber. Due to its composite nature, it is much less likely to warp, twist, bow, or shrink. Used in a staggered wall design, it will provide an even higher R-value than Tstuds. The only downside is that it is 5x more expensive than regular lumber and roughly 35% more than the Tstuds.
